body          {background:#ba3232;font-family:Arial;font-size:12px;} 
a:link        {text-decoration:none;}
a:visited     {text-decoration:none;}
a:active      {text-decoration:none;}
a:hover       {text-decoration:underline;}



.main         {position:absolute;background: url(../images/hg.jpg) no-repeat;width: 785px;height: 777px;/*zentriert die Page*/left:50%;margin-left: -392px;}

.headercontent  {position:absolute;width:500px;height:100px;top:30px;left:30px;}
.breadcrumb     {position:absolute;width:400px;height:20px;top:166px;left:23px;}
.mainnavi       {position:absolute;width:170px;height:26px;top:325px;left:20px;}
.header         {position:absolute;width:185px;height:30px;top:166px;left:480px;}
.maincontent    {position:absolute;width:497px;height:479px;top:226px;left:226px;overflow:auto;}
.navifooter     {position:absolute;width:500px;height:20px;top:735px;left:225px;}

.maincontent .csc-textpic {margin:1px;padding:3px}
.maincontent .bodytext    {margin:1px;padding:3px}


/*Überschrift über dem Content*/
.header .bodytext     {margin:3px;padding:1px;color:rgb(255,207,49);font-size:10px;}

/*Überschrift im Kreisel*/
.headercontent h1     {margin:3px 1 1 7px;color:rgb(255,207,49);}

/*Brotkrümelleiste*/
.breadcrumb ul        {margin:1px;padding:0px;}
.breadcrumb span      {float:left;}
.breadcrumb ul li     {display:inline;color:rgb(255,207,49);}
.breadcrumb ul li a   {color:rgb(255,207,49);}

/*Hauptnavigation*/
/*Ebene 1*/
.mainnavi ul          {margin:0px;padding:0 0 0 15px;}
.mainnavi ul li       {padding:3px 0 5px 0px;list-style:none;width: 139px;}
.mainnavi ul li a     {color:#000;font-weight:bold;padding:0 0 7px 35px;height: 20px;font-size:13px;}
.mainnavi ul li a.act, .mainnavi ul li a:hover   {background: url(../images/pfeil.gif) no-repeat;}

/*Ebene 2*/
.mainnavi ul ul       {padding:0px;margin-top:-10px 0 0 3px;}
.mainnavi ul ul li    {margin:0px;padding:0px;background: none;}
.mainnavi ul ul li a  {height:20px;font-size:11px;font-weight:normal;background: none;}
.mainnavi ul ul li a:hover            {background: none;}

/*Footernavigation*/
.navifooter ul        {margin:0px;padding:0px;text-align:right;color:#fff;}
.navifooter ul li     {display:inline;}
.navifooter ul li a   {color:#fff;font-weight:bold;}          


/*Googlemap*/
.tx_lumogooglemaps_pi1_sidebar {display:hidden;}

